Strategies for Addressing Aquatic Damage Right Away

Confronting water damage calls for prompt action. The opening moves can greatly minimize the impact on property and belongings. First, one should disable the main water supply to avoid further flooding. Next, electrical supply should be shut off to sidestep potential hazards. Removing standing water swiftly is vital; this may involve using a wet/dry vacuum, buckets, or mops.

As the bulk of the water is drained away, the compromised space should be thoroughly dehumidified. Leaving windows open and using fans can increase airflow, helping with moisture evaporation. It is also essential to take out any damp materials, such as carpets or furniture, to prevent fungal development.

To conclude, capturing the damage with pictures can be beneficial for insurance claims. By taking these immediate actions, one can help mitigate the long-term effects of moisture damage and set up professional restoration services.

The Structured Water Damage Rebuilding Approach

Water damage restoration encompasses a structured approach to effectively reclaim affected areas and mitigate further difficulties. The undertaking typically commences with a thorough assessment to ascertain the extent of the damage and discover the source of water intrusion. Then, technicians commence water extraction, utilizing advanced equipment to remove standing water and reduce humidity levels. When the area is dry, they prioritize on cleaning and sanitizing affected surfaces to expunge contaminants and prevent mold growth.

After this, the repair stage involves fixing or substituting harmed components, such as drywall, flooring, and insulation, making certain that the space goes back to its original state. Throughout the process, clear dialogue with property owners is vital to maintain their awareness. Final inspections are performed to verify that all repairs satisfy industry standards, confirming the property is safe and habitable once more. Important Tools for Successful Water Damage Remediation

Reliable water damage restoration is substantially dependent on sophisticated equipment that amplify the performance and achievement of the activity. Key instruments incorporate humidity sensors, which precisely quantify moisture percentages in various materials, ensuring thorough drying. Industrial-grade dehumidifiers are instrumental for removing substantial water vapor from the air, warding off biological contamination. Additionally, efficient extraction systems quickly remove standing water, decreasing losses to facilities and contents.

Air movers play a key role in promoting airflow and accelerating evaporation, whereas thermal imaging cameras assist in identifying hidden moisture spots behind walls and under floors. These tools, when used together, establish a comprehensive restoration method that allows for fast and effective recovery. Variables That Impact Moisture Damage Repair Expenses

There are several factors that affect the costs involved with water damage restoration, impacting both the extent of work and overall expenses. The level of the damage is a main factor; larger areas affected by water need more labor and materials. The water source also plays a crucial role—clean water, gray water, and black water require different treatment levels and safety measures. In addition, the type of damaged materials, such as drywall, flooring, or personal belongings, influences total costs. The timeliness is another important factor; quicker interventions often reduce expenses by preventing additional damage. Geographic location can also affect pricing, given that labor rates and material costs differ by region. Lastly, any necessary structural repairs or replacements will increase total expenses, underscoring the relevant resource importance of thorough assessments when estimating restoration costs.

How Can I Shield My House from Future Water-Related Damage?

To prevent future water damage, regular inspections of plumbing, roofs, and gutters are essential. Maintaining proper drainage, sealing leaks, and installing sump pumps can significantly decrease the risk of moisture infiltration and subsequent damage.

Which Protection Coverage Is Required for Water Damage Recovery?

To properly address water damage remediation, homeowners should secure broad homeowners insurance, verifying it includes explicit coverage for water damage. Supplemental flood insurance may also be vital, determined by the property's location and flood risk.

Is DIY Water Damage Restoration Successful and Secure?

Do-it-yourself water damage remediation can be efficient for minor issues, but they may create safety hazards and could cause more harm if not executed properly. Professional inspection is often recommended for major or intricate cases.

What timeline Can You anticipate for Water Damage restoration?

Addressing aquatic damage typically demands between a few days to several weeks, influenced by the amount of harm, the impacted materials, and the efficacy of the drying process executed by professionals.

What Health Issues Are Tied With Water Damage?

Water damage presents numerous health dangers, including mold growth, which can result in respiratory issues, allergies, and infections. Contaminated water may also harbor pathogens, raising the likelihood of gastrointestinal diseases and other serious health concerns.
